Output 81abaaba96c0d4bcdbce28bdd474bc2850d964cb31dbbcedf94fa3b233f2b912: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a08a2711da1ef31caa4ed32cc12795536d4e1d OP_EQUAL
address
33Cw46zN1YDWWcpLXx69DpxLyeDuVQXtjZ
transaction
81abaaba96c0d4bcdbce28bdd474bc2850d964cb31dbbcedf94fa3b233f2b912
confirmations
157639
spent
true